    Angelique offers a unique opportunity to explore the art of pottery through her two-and-a-half-hour -site workshop, hosted at the venue of your choice. This workshop brings the traditionally stationary potter's wheel, weighing 75kg, directly to the participants. This mobility is a rare feature in the realm of ceramics, making Angelique's workshop an exceptional experience.

    Participants will be immersed in the world of ceramics, gaining valuable insights and hands-on experience. The workshop is structured to allow each individual to craft two distinct bowls, employing different techniques. The first bowl will be shaped on the potter's wheel, offering a chance to engage with this classic tool in a dynamic setting. The second bowl will be crafted using the modelling technique, allowing for a more freeform and sculptural approach to pottery.

    The raw clay provided serves as a blank canvas, inviting participants to mould their unique creations. Following the workshop, there is an option for Angelique to professionally bake and glaze the crafted items. Participants can later collect their finished pieces from Angelique's workshop. This visit not only allows them to retrieve their creations but also offers a glimpse into Angelique's professional environment and her artistic process.

    Angelique Homberg, a talented ceramist born in 1967 and based in Amsterdam, is a true visionary in the world of ceramics. Having graduated from the prestigious Gerrit Rietveld Academy in Amsterdam with a specialisation in Ceramics Design, Angelique has honed her craft and developed a unique approach to her art.

    Working primarily on a potter's wheel, Angelique's creative process is a fascinating blend of skill and intuition. Rather than sketching on paper, she allows the clay to guide her hands, focusing on the form and embracing the craft of turning. Her aim is to push the limits of shape, finding the delicate balance between a visually captivating piece and one that retains its utilitarian purpose.

    Beyond her personal creations, Angelique Homberg possesses an extensive background in restoration work. She has breathed new life into a diverse range of objects, from broken sculptures to tile walls, showcasing her ability to revive and reimagine existing forms. Furthermore, Angelique welcomes collaborative projects, eagerly working with clients to bring their unique ideas and sketches to life.

    But Angelique's artistic journey doesn't stop there. She is also a passionate teacher, offering workshops that cover various aspects of pottery, sculpting, and painted dishware. In her intimate studio located in the heart of Amsterdam, small groups have the opportunity to delve into the world of ceramics under her expert guidance. Participants not only learn the techniques and skills necessary to create their own masterpieces but also have the chance to return and glaze their pottery or sculpture, adding a personal touch and enhancing the final result.

    For those seeking a one-of-a-kind experience, Angelique hosts special events where participants can paint on hand-thrown dishware. Each stroke of the brush becomes a moment of self-expression, resulting in a unique piece that showcases both the individual's artistic style and Angelique's expert glazing techniques.
